Instructions to enable video/movie file while driving..

1. Open the glove compartment by pressing 2 points on the upper part (as shown in the picture) towards inside.

user posted image

2. After the glove compartment had been removed, you will see 3 points as shown below.
i. Back of display screen
ii. Glove compartment lock
iii. Leg of glove compartment

user posted image

3. If you peek behind the screen from the glove compartment, you will notice a plug attached to the screen. Pull it out (by doing this you will disconnecting the power to the screen)

user posted image

4. Now, noticed there are two blue cables connecting the plug. One of them is bigger in size. This is the cable you must cut.

5. Next, get a cable and attached it with the blue cable that being cut before (connect with blue cable in plug). The other end of the attached cable need to be grounded through car (as shown in picture)

user posted image

user posted image

user posted image

6. Attached the plug again at it place.

7. Test whether it’s working or not (Should be fine if done correctly).
